at the table is robert dunham. ert dunham, executive director of the death penalty information center. good morning. thank you for joining us. guest: thank you for having me. host: what is the death penalty information center? guest: it is a national nonprofit organization. we provide information and analysis on death penalty issues. we don't take a position for or against the death penalty itself. host: one story that got her attention recently is this headline, governor kevin newsom from california has suspended the death penalty. what is going on? guest: california has the largest death row. they have not executed anybody in a decade. there have been a lot of voter referenda to figure out what is going to happen. the governor was faced with the decision. he was being asked to approve a death penalty protocol, the manner by which people get executed. he went from having an intellectual issue to an emotional issue. am i going to preside over the executions of 25 people whose appeals have been exhausted? host: let'

( robert) ( robert)death row inmates in california are getting a reprieve wednesday as gov. gavin newsom plans to place a moratorium on the death penalty in the state, his office announced tuesday. the move immediately closes the execution chamber at san quentin state prison where executions in california are carried out, though no one has been executed since 2006. currently, there are 737 condemned inmates in california. "i do not believe that a civilized society can claim to be a leader in the world as long as its government continues to sanction the premeditated and discriminatory execution of its people," newsom said in a statement.
